Who Should Buy the Paper Product Supplies?

Who pays for paper products at an office? You know, the toilet paper, the folding paper towels and the rolls of paper towels. The decision
maker for a large office building told me that he wanted my price to
include all of the paper products used in the building. No way!!

Janitorial supply businesses are commonly the source of all paper
products for small offices and large office buildings. I would respectfully
suggest to the office manager that they set up an account with a local janitorial supply store. You can be responsible for ordering these paper products when they are low and they can be delivered to the office and paid for by the office.

This is how it should be done. There is no way that you can know how much paper products they may use in an office or office building. For this reason I suggest that you offer to order them for the office as need be, but not pay for them.

Just order them when they are low and the janitorial supply company
should bill the office or the decision maker who has set up an account
for doing it this way.

Research Your Customer's Business BEFORE You Bid

BIDDING TIP


This is a great icebreaker that you can use for your cleaning business and it will really work to your advantage, too!

Briefly study up and read some information on the internet about the business (or industry) that you are going to give your bid to.


You can easily and quickly do a search online for some interesting fact or current development associated with the type of business that your potential customer is in before you meet them in person.

For example:

If you know that on Monday morning you are going to go and give a bid to the decision maker of an advertising agency.

Briefly look for some facts about that industry (from a quick search on Google or Yahoo) such as the growth in general and/or the trend in general of that type of business. Using this information in small talk would then be very influential if you were applying for a job to work there as an employee or submitting a bid because they would be impressed with your knowledge of their business and they would remember their conversation with you because of it. Few if any cleaning business owners do a little homework like this before going in to submit a bid and talk with a decision maker.

When you do meet the decision maker, you can mention to them that you read, (such and such) about the business (their business).

You will find them to be very impressed by your knowledge of their business and it will actually assist you in getting their office as a new account and in gaining their favor before you even begin to talk about the price for your cleaning service. Make this small talk / facts /a part of your bidding process because it will help you get the account.
